My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Rusty and 9 other dogs from the same backyard breeder came into our rescue after the breeder decided "he had too many dogs." As he was leaving to go to Mexico, he decided he needed a place for all these dogs to go immediately or he told us that he would just dump them all at a kill shelter. Thanks to help from our fosters, we were able to accommodate taking in all 9 dogs.

Rusty is a little male Chihuahua puppy and he came into rescue with his mother, Letty, and his 4 siblings, Tiki, Tanner, Tigger and Timmy. At the time we received them into rescue, they were 4 weeks old. They have now been weaned from mom and placed in a separate foster home to play, grow and learn. They've had their first set of shots and will be getting their second set shortly. They are currently around 8 weeks old and very, very cute.

Rusty is the lover of the group. He just wants to snuggle on your lap and nap. He has no problem showing the ladies his insulated puppy 6-pack if it means he's going to get a belly rub. Lol. He's super curious about all that goes on around him. He gets along great with his siblings and loves to wrestle and play with them. He is a typical puppy - play, eat, sleep and repeat. He is a little darker colored than Tanner and Timmy. Rusty is more of a red/rust colored puppy.
